Tallyframe evaluates user-supplied formulas inside a sandboxed interpreter with strict CPU and memory caps. If you see repeated sandbox-kill alerts, it usually means a tenant uploaded a recursive formula; do not raise the caps without approval. Escalation paths, cap values, and the allowlisted function table are documented on the internal sandbox page.

runbook for badug-kadup: https://confluence.zemvarlabs.internal/projects/browse/display/projects/bd1b

New starters at Fennimore & Vance occasionally need to retrieve legacy case files from the archive room, located in the basement one level below the loading dock. Please note that the room is climate-controlled, so the door must never be propped open, and all files must be signed out in the ledger kept on the shelf immediately inside. Access is restricted to staff who have completed records training with the Archives team. Once your training is confirmed, you may enter using the door code below.

door code, yagap-bahof: bdg-O-05

// CONSENT_BANNER_ROLLOUT_PCT
//
// Gates the Opaline consent banner for the Brindlewood
// market launch. Currently 25%; legal wants 100% by the
// quarter close. Do not bump past 50% until the dismissal
// metrics from the Kestrelview cohort stabilize — last
// bump caused a spike in abandoned checkouts. Raise at the
// weekly sync only, with sign-off. The deploy this value
// shipped in is tagged just below.

session token of bawep-yadup = htk21_528abd376e3c5a4ec24a1

## Authentication

As part of the Kilnworks migration to the hermetic build system, remote cache reads now require authentication — the old anonymous mirror is gone. Each build agent fetches toolchains through the sealed artifact proxy, which validates checksums before admission. For the weekly sync demo, use the shared staging credential. The proxy key for the staging cache is below.

gateway credential: kto23_dolYgAScEh2TaPOlStqOl98

Welcome to the Spokeshift rebalancing tool

Spokeshift predicts which bike-share docks in the Marrowton network will run empty and routes the van crews accordingly. As a contractor, you'll run it locally: copy config/spokeshift.env.example to spokeshift.env and fill in SS_CITY and SS_FORECAST_WINDOW. The dispatch API also requires a credential, which should appear on the next line.

sealed setting: ARCHIVE_KEY3=8d0